Cleveland Browns Make A Significant Declaration

Pittsburgh — After the Pittsburgh Steelers’ thrilling victory over the Jacksonville Jaguars in Week 14, the team’s main rivals in the AFC North have announced the selection of a new starting quarterback. Following the team’s 31-27 victory over Jacksonville, head coach Kevin Stefanski of the Cleveland Browns declared that Joe Flacco would be the starting quarterback going forward. Flacco will lead the team in a close battle with the Pittsburgh Steelers for an AFC Wild Card spot as the regular season draws to a close.

The 38-year-old Flacco signed with the Browns last month following the news that Deshaun Watson had sustained an injury that would end his season. Two weeks after joining the practice squad, he was named the starting lineup. Flacco threw for 254 yards, two touchdowns, and an interception in a loss to the Los Angeles Rams in his first game action in more than a year. This week, Flacco and the Browns recovered. This week, in a game Cleveland won 31-27 over the Jaguars, he passed for 311 yards, three touchdowns, and an interception.

One spot ahead of the sixth-place Steelers in the AFC Playoff rankings, the Browns currently occupy the fifth seed. The season series was tied 1-1 between these two AFC North rivals.
